Transaction

8d3cd19059f6ce7c7efb4f2b5367f659c2a97ca072db36c1496e7f7a44c6f731
366,181 confirmations
Timestamp
1556398435
Block573,519
Fee6,418 sats
Fee rate28.7 sats/vB
view on mempool.space

Inputs & Outputs